Contact lenses can offer you the freedom from bespectacled looks but can cause several eye infections and corneal ulcer. These disorders spread quickly and though rare it might lead towards blindness. There are several reasons related to contact lens infections. The most common is the negligence of the person who is wearing it.
If you are facing eye irritation or itching, immediately remove your contact lenses and wear it again only after proper medical tests. There are several symptoms like eye pain, discharge, red eyes, blurred vision and a feeling as if something is there is your eyes that might indicate a contact lenses infection. Hygiene level of the contact lens is the vital factor behind infection. People forget to clean the storage case of the contact lenses in regular interval. It leads to the direct interaction between micro organisms and your lenses.
Hence, you need to clean the storage case in every three months. Using tap water or distilled water to clean the contact lenses makes them vulnerable towards microorganisms.
